  7. Cash can actually sometimes hurt the negotiation as they make money in finance. I'd actually tell them you plan to finance with them and when it comes time in finance pay cash. What will make the salesman move is to be firm with your offers and 100% prepared to walk away if you don't get the deal you want. 9 out of 10 car deals I make, I get up to leave at least 2x in the process of negotiating.
